With custom fields, you can:
- Track extra details on timesheets, like mileage, equipment, tasks, and more!
- Assign specific fields to jobs/customers.
- Make the fields required or optional.
- Allow team members to enter the information as free-form text or select options from a drop-down list.
Notes:
- Some integrations can import tracking options as custom fields in QuickBooks Time. These fields are enabled/disabled via that integration's preferences menu, and the items within the field are edited within the integrated software.
- If team members are using an Android device, custom fields only works correctly on Android version 5.1 or higher.
- Only six custom fields can be active at a time.
To Install:
- Go to Feature Add-ons, then select Manage Add-ons.
- Under Get More, find Custom Fields and select Install.
How to:
- Create a Field
- Add, Edit, or Delete Items Within a Field
- Assign and Restrict Fields and Items
- Archive a Field
- Restore a Field
Create a Field
- Go to Feature Add-ons, then select Custom Fields.
- Select + Add Field, then select Timesheet field.
- Add a name and, under Type, choose one of the following:
- List: Use this when you have a list of items/options for users to pick from on their time card. This can be used for equipment or task lists.
- At least one item must be added before saving this field type. Select + Add Item, then enter the item's name and Save.
- Individual items can be assigned to show up only for specific jobs/customers and/or team members.
- Text: Use this when you need a free-form text field for users to enter their own text. This can be used for descriptions or explanations.
- Whole Number: Use this for a numbers only text field (i.e., 42, 7, 10). This can be used for entering mileage or amounts.
- Decimal Number: Use this if you want a numbers only text field, but allow for decimal numbers (i.e., 3.14, 10.5, 34.06). This can be used for entering expenses or measurements.Note: If something other than a number value is entered in a number field, the user will get an error stating: "Problem saving timecard. Enter only whole/decimal numbers for the "Title" field."
- List: Use this when you have a list of items/options for users to pick from on their time card. This can be used for equipment or task lists.
- Other Options:
- Show for all jobs/customers: Check if the field should be visible on all time cards. Uncheck if the field should only show up for certain Jobs/Customers. (see "assign and restrict fields and items" below.)
- Required: Check if this field must be filled out before clocking out. Uncheck if the field is optional.Note: If a list field is required and only has one item in the list or only one item is assigned to a customer/job or team member, the field will auto-populate on timesheets.
Add, edit, or delete items in a list
As an example: an Equipment list could include: Excavator, bulldozer, loader, etc.
- Go to Feature Add-ons, then select Custom Fields.
- Select the field you want to edit.
- Add, edit, or remove an item:
- To add an item: Select + Add Item, enter the name, and go back, or select More, then Import/export items, choose a . DZ file, and select Import.
- To edit an item: Select an item, make the change, and go back.
- To archive an item: In the Edit Field window, select the three grey dots
, then Archive item. To archive multiple items, check the box to the left of each item and select Archive.
- To unarchive an item: In the Edit Field window, select Archived from the Show dropdown, and at the right of the item name, select the three grey dots
, then select Unarchive item. To unarchive multiple items, check the box to the right of each item and select Unarchive.
- After all changes are made, select Save.
Assign and restrict fields and items
As an example, if you have team members working at the Smith residence, they should only see the "Equipment" fields and only "Bulldozer" and "Excavator" to be selectable options within that field. This can help prevent accidentally selecting the wrong item or needing to fill out unnecessary fields.
To assign and restrict fields to jobs/customers:
- Go to Feature Add-ons, then select Custom Fields.
- Navigate to the field you want to be restricted and select it.
- Clear Show for all jobs/customers and do one of the following:
- In the Edit field window, select None selected.
- Check desired jobs or customers from the Jobs list.
- Select Save and the field will only show up for the selected jobs or customers.
Or
- Go to Jobs or Customers.
- Select
next to the job or customer to which you want to adjust the assignment.
- Under Custom fields, select the desired field(s) to have that field appear on a timesheet for that job, then select Save.
To assign and restrict field items to jobs/customers:
- Go to Jobs or Customers.
- Select
next to the job or customer to which you want to adjust the assignment.
- Under Custom fields, next to the list field you want to choose from, select All items.
- Assign or unassign items:
- Select
to move options from the Unassigned Items box to the Assigned Items box.
- Select
to move options from the Assigned Items box to the Unassigned Items box.
- Sub-level jobs, if not manually changed, will reflect the assignments for any top level job. Assign or unassign the associated sub-level jobs or customers, if needed.
- Select Save.
- Select
To assign and restrict field items to team members:
- Go to Feature Add-ons, then select Custom Fields, select a field, and an item.
- Clear team members to unassign them from that item, or check team members to assign them.
Or
- Go to My Team and select a team member.
- Select Custom fields and select the blue link under Items.
- Clear items to unassign them from that team member, or check items to assign them.Note: Items that are assigned at the company level will be greyed out and must first be unassigned from Feature Add-ons, then Custom Fields.
Archive a field
- Go to Feature Add-ons, then Custom Fields.
- Next to a field, select the three grey dots
, and select Archive field.
To only "hide" the field from all time cards:
- Go to Feature Add-ons, then Custom Fields and select the field.
- Clear Show for all Jobs, leave it set to None selected, and select Save.
Restore a field
Note: Any assignments and restrictions will also be restored.
- Go to Feature Add-ons, then select Custom Fields.
- Select Archived from the Show dropdown.
- Next to a field, select the three grey dots
, then Unarchive.
Or, if the field was not archived, just hidden from time cards and needs to appear on all time cards:
- Go to Feature Add-ons, then Custom Fields and select the field.
- Select Show on all Jobs, and select Save.